Coldplay have donated a piano to the flood victims of a village in the Cotswolds.
The band gave St David’s School in Moreton £3,072 so it could buy a new piano. The school lost all of its musical equipment in the summer floods of 2007.
Christina Windridge, a teaching assistant at St David’s, told the Cotswold Journal that the school were “just so grateful to them because we have been able to use this money.”
"The money that we would have had to use to pay for the piano has been used to buy other keyboard equipment,” she added.
